The AC Unit Water Removal Process: What to Expect
When you call us for AC unit water removal, you can expect a smooth and efficient process from start to finish. Our team will arrive on-site quickly, assess the situation, and get to work right away. We’ll use only the latest equipment and techniques to remove the water and dry out your property, ensuring that your AC unit is back up and running in no time.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will arrive on-site and assess the situation, determining the extent of the damage and the best course of action. We’ll work with you to create a plan that meets your needs and budget, and we’ll get to work right away.
Step 2: Water Removal
We’ll use only the latest equipment to remove the water from your property, including powerful pumps and wet vacuums. Our team will work efficiently to get the job done quickly, reducing disruption to your daily routine.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been removed,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out your property and prevent further damage. We’ll monitor the humidity levels and adjust our equipment as needed to ensure that your property is completely dry.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ect your property to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. We’ll use only the latest equipment and techniques to ensure that your property is safe and healthy.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Once the cleaning and disinfection process is complete, our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. We’ll repair any damage, replace any necessary materials, and get your AC unit up and running in no time.

AC Unit Water Removal Cost in Bourg, LA
The cost of AC unit water removal in Bourg, LA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ate for the job, and we’ll work with you to create a plan that meets your needs and bud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| AC unit repair or repl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, type of repair or replacement needed, local conditions |
| Dehumidification and air purification |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Inspection and ass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Permitting and inspections |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Disinfection and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we’ll provide you with a free estimate for the job. Our team will work with you to create a plan that meets your needs and budget, and we’ll get the job done right.
